Structured Estimation in Nonparameteric Cox Model (1207.4510v3)

Published 18 Jul 2012 in math.ST, stat.ME, stat.ML, and stat.TH

Abstract: To better understand the interplay of censoring and sparsity we develop finite sample properties of nonparametric Cox proportional hazard's model. Due to high impact of sequencing data, carrying genetic information of each individual, we work with over-parametrized problem and propose general class of group penalties suitable for sparse structured variable selection and estimation. Novel non-asymptotic sandwich bounds for the partial likelihood are developed. We establish how they extend notion of local asymptotic normality (LAN) of Le Cam's. Such non-asymptotic LAN principles are further extended to high dimensional spaces where $p \gg n$. Finite sample prediction properties of penalized estimator in non-parametric Cox proportional hazards model, under suitable censoring conditions, agree with those of penalized estimator in linear models.
